Cream Mandarine Xl Auto by Sweet Seeds

Ruderalis × Indica × Sativa

Cream Mandarine XL Auto is an autoflowering cannabis strain developed by Sweet Seeds. It combines ruderalis, indica, and sativa genetics to produce a balanced plant with desirable cultivation traits and a complex sensory profile. This variety is recognized for its potency and ease of growth.

Appearance

Cream Mandarine XL Auto plants typically exhibit deep green foliage interspersed with orange and purple hues. The buds are dense and conical, often comparable to those of photoperiod strains, and are covered in a generous layer of trichomes, giving them a sticky, resinous quality.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ma is dominated by distinct citrus notes, particularly mandarin orange, complemented by subtle earthy undertones. Its flavor profile mirrors the aroma, offering a sweet and tangy taste reminiscent of fresh mandarin juice, with a smooth, creamy finish that contributes to its name.

Effects

This strain is reported to produce a calming sensation and a cerebral uplift. Its balanced genetic background suggests a nuanced effect profile that can be enjoyed by both novice and experienced users.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Cream Mandarine XL Auto is known for its high THC content, reaching up to 23%. While specific terpene levels are not detailed, the aroma and flavor profiles suggest the presence of terpenes like Myrcene, Limonene, and Caryophyllene, which contribute to its citrusy, spicy, and calming characteristics. CBD content is typically less than 1%.

Growing

As an autoflower, Cream Mandarine XL Auto does not require photoperiod adjustments to initiate flowering, making it suitable for various cultivation environments. Its genetics contribute to vigorous growth and stable phenotypes, often yielding impressive results for both indoor and outdoor growers.

Origins & Lineage

Developed by Sweet Seeds, Cream Mandarine XL Auto is a hybrid strain resulting from the crossbreeding of ruderalis, indica, and sativa genetics. This blend provides the plant with its automatic flowering trait, indica-like bud structure and calming influence, and sativa-like cerebral qualities and aroma complexity.
